Eynsham water leak affects supply to more than 1,000 homes

In a further post from the Witney MP at 20:30 GMT, a Thames Water worker said: “We’re hearing people are experiencing low pressure, not really no water at the minute.”

The Liberal Democrat added: “Over in Eynsham, there is a diver in a crater right now… and they’re putting a collar round the pipe.”

In a statement, Thames Water said: “We are very sorry for the disruption this incident is causing and understand how worrying and inconvenient this situation will be for customers affected.

“We’re currently responding to a critical burst water main in a field next to Oxford Road, OX29.

“This 800mm main feeds the reservoirs that supply… postcodes OX7, OX18, OX28, OX29, GL7.”

In a later update, external at 21:30, the firm said: “The damaged section of pipe has now been successfully isolated.

“Our crews will be working overnight to carefully excavate around the damaged section of the 800mm main so that permanent repairs can be safely carried out.”
